Discover McNeal, Arizona

Nestled in Cochise County, McNeal, AZ is a quiet rural community known for wide-open skies and desert vistas. This unincorporated area sits between historic Bisbee and legendary Tombstone, making it a strategic base for exploring southeastern Arizona.


Nature and Location

Outdoor enthusiasts flock to nearby Whitewater Draw Wildlife Area to witness wintering sandhill cranes and remarkable birdwatching. The surrounding Chiricahua and Dragoon Mountains offer hiking, rock formations, and cooler high-elevation escapes. Clear, low-light-pollution nights make McNeal a prime spot for stargazing and astrophotography.


Lifestyle, Real Estate, and Travel

Local economy leans on ranching and small-scale agriculture, while services and dining are found in nearby towns. Real estate typically features acreage and ranch properties, appealing to buyers seeking privacy, views, and room for homesteading. General aviation users fly into Bisbee?Douglas International (DUG), while most visitors drive from Tucson International (TUS) via scenic highways. Weather is classic high-desert: warm, dry days, cool nights, and a summer monsoon that greens the rangeland.
